Enhancing Healthcare Diagnostics With Optical Technologies



Optical innovations are revolutionizing health care diagnostics, much like they have actually changed making processes. You can see just how these developments enable faster, extra exact disease detection and surveillance. For instance, optical comprehensibility tomography (OCT) provides high-resolution photos of the retina, permitting very early discovery of conditions like glaucoma and diabetic retinopathy.


Moreover, fluorescence microscopy can aid you determine specific cellular pens, enhancing cancer cells diagnostics. With non-invasive methods like optical spectroscopy, you have the ability to analyze tissue homes, using real-time insights without the requirement for biopsies.


These advancements not only boost individual results yet also improve operations in scientific settings. By incorporating optical dimension systems into diagnostics, you're guaranteeing a much more reliable technique to medical care. As these innovations remain to develop, you can expect also greater developments in precision medication, resulting in tailored treatments that accommodate specific client demands.

Innovations in Optical Dimension for Environmental Surveillance



Optical measurement innovations have actually substantially evolved, improving our ability to monitor ecological adjustments with unmatched precision. You can currently take advantage of progressed sensors that make use of light to identify air high quality, water pureness, and even biodiversity. These systems supply real-time data, enabling you to react promptly to environmental hazards.


For example, remote picking up strategies allow the evaluation of logging and uncontrolled development, utilizing satellite imagery to track modifications in time. Spectroscopy approaches have enhanced your ability to recognize toxins at minute concentrations, ensuring compliance with ecological regulations.


Additionally, developments in LiDAR innovation enable exact topographic mapping, important for flood danger administration and habitat conservation. By incorporating these optical dimension systems into your environmental monitoring methods, you'll get valuable understandings that drive educated decision-making and promote sustainability. Welcoming these technologies can equip you to secure our earth more successfully than ever before.
